A small dog breed that typically gets along well with cats and has a calm temperament is a Maltese. They are known to be gentle and companionable, which may help facilitate a peaceful coexistence with your two cats. Introduce them slowly and under supervision to ensure a smooth transition.

No, huskies don't usually get along with small animals like cats and they have a tendancy to play rough so there is a chance that it could seriously hurt the cat. If you are getting a labrador while it is still a puppy, then yes the dog will usually get along with the cat since they will have grown up together. and it also depends if the cat is used to dogs, if not the cat may run from the dog or attack when the dog is near it and they will not get along.
